I've been experiencing the specimen "kill stutter" on other maps while playing through some of the contest maps on Solo. I've noticed it's more apparent on some maps compared to others - it may be the size or custom resources that's the contributing factor. I noticed it the most while playing KFS-Degeneration and first though it was due to the Single Player gametype.

So far, I've tried: lowest/highest settings, tweaking settings with RivaTuner, disabling precaching, restoring defaults and deleting KillingFloor.ini and User.ini.

It is likely something to do with processing power and how the Unreal Engine 2.5 handles things (probably ignores graphics memory and tries to swamp the processor). As it's not optimised for multiple cores, most dual and quad cores are effectively single cores to the game.

I'm running an Intel Core 2 Duo E6600 with 2.4GHz per core. I'm wondering if forcing the game to use the least used core will improve performance.

Anyone not have this issue?

[Edit]
No change in making the game use one of the two cores. I've noticed it pauses for barely a second just before the specimen is attacked/dies. It's happening randomly in a space of 10 seconds, usually with 1/10 specimen. This issue may be confined to Solo, gonna try online.

I think the kill stutter only happens in Solo for me. I haven't experienced it at all in Multiplayer today (or before). I'll test running through without the intro though.

The stutter also happens with two other maps: KF-BellTolls (slight) and KF-WaterworksV2 (noticable), so it's not just a problem solely with the Degeneration map.

CacheSizeMegs (tried default and have it set to 256 presently) and turning off precaching had no effect on the issue. I've found precaching off is more of a performance hit during the game. Map loading times are fine with it enabled.

I'm not really bothered by the issue so much as it's confined to Solo with a few maps. I'll try playing around with the single player map and see if there's any servers running the multiplayer.
